Historic Period Cultural Resources Specialist

 

Pacific Legacy, Inc., a cultural resources consulting firm, is currently
accepting applications for a position in their Cameron Park office near
Sacramento, California.   The position is for a mid-to-senior level
supervisor with expertise in historic period resources.  This will be a
full-time, benefited position responsible for managing projects.  Applicants
must have:

 

*       an M.A. or M.S. in history, archaeology, or other appropriate
CRM-related field;
*       three years full-time experience in CRM;
*       one year full-time supervisory experience;
*       proven writing skills; and
*       expertise in historical research, architectural description, and
historical archaeology as they pertain to California.  

 

Preferred applicants will be competent at using the Harris Matrix system,
have a working knowledge of CEQA and NEPA, and be comfortable guiding
clients through the NHPA Section 106 process.   The position will require an
individual who is a self starter, articulate, organized, and is interested
in working in a team environment.
